description | The present invention relates to a method for propelling a vehicle (100),the vehicle (100) comprising:a first power source (101) configured to selectively provide a controllable power to propel at least one drive wheel (113, 114) of said vehicle (100), the first power source being an internal combustion engine (101);a second power source (110) configured to selectively provide a controllable power to propel at least one drive wheel (113, 114) of said vehicle (100), the second power source comprising at least one electrical machine (110);an energy store (111) for powering said second power source (110) when said second power source (110) provides a propelling power to said at least one drive wheel, the energy store (111) being chargeable by regenerative braking. The method comprises, when to climb an uphill (302):based on topography data, determining a control of said first (101) and second (110) power source when climbing said uphill (302),determining whether to charge said energy store (111) prior to climbing said uphill (302) based on said determination of said control of said first (101) and second (110) power source, andapplying a regenerative brake force (PCHARGE; PCHARGE2) when said energy store (111) is to be charged. |
